MANILA, Philippines — The COVID-19 positivity rate in the National Capital Region (NCR) has already reached five percent, surpassing the World Health Organization’s (WHO) benchmark, independent analytics group Octa Research said on Wednesday.

 

The WHO earlier recommended a five-percent threshold for COVID-19 positivity rate.

“NCR positivity is 5.5% as of yesterday,” Octa Research fellow Guido David told INQUIRER.net in a message.

“We are seeing an increase in cases in Metro Manila, Western Visayas, and a few other provinces. It’s becoming a cause for concern, though not cause for alarm yet,” he said on ANC’s Headstart.
